Michael Fitzmaurice (Roscommon-South Leitrim, Independent) | Oireachtas source
These apply in the west but they also apply in every other part of Ireland. The Central Statistics Office has released its figures, which I have no reason to doubt and which show that there are 4,000 fewer people working in the three counties to which I referred than there was in 2013.
The Taoiseach talks about farmers. We should have someone on an aeroplane to meet the agriculture Minister for in England. Yesterday, the beef barons of Ireland and England announced that cattle exported from Ireland to England would take €1 per kilogram less. This has effectively stopped our exports to England. We should have someone addressing that.
The fact is that the TEN-T funding for major infrastructural projects, such as Knock Airport in the Taoiseach's county, the ring road in Galway, and a main road from Dublin to Castlebar, which is needed, was stopped by this Government in 2011.
